摘要
高程测量在工程建设中具有重要作用,常见的几种高程测量方法有GNSS高程测量、水准测量与三角高程测量,首先简要介绍几种高程测量方法,并对水准测量与三角高程测量的误差源简要分析,然后通过工程实例对几种高程测量方法进行精度对比,为实际工作中选择最佳测量方案提供理论支撑。
Height surveying plays an important role in engineering construction.Several common height surveying methods include GNSS height surveying,level height surveying,and triangulated height surveying.First,several height surveying methods are briefly introduced,and the error sources of leveling and triangulated height surveying are briefly analyzed.Then,an engineering example is used to compare the accuracy of several elevation-survey methods to provide theoretical support for selecting the best surveying scheme in actual work.
